Digital Ecosystem OntoMath as an Approach to Building the Space of Mathematical Knowledge

Alexander Mikhailovich Eizarov, Alexander Vitalevich Kirillovich, Evgeny Konstantinovich Lipachev, Olga Avenirovna Nevzorova
154–202
Abstract:

The results on the creation of methods for managing mathematical knowledge in the context of digital mathematical libraries are presented. The software tools developed on the basis of these methods are part of the OntoMath digital ecosystem, within which they interact. A brief description of the architecture of the OntoMath ecosystem is given, the levels of subject ontologies and external ontologies are highlighted, as well as the level of software tools and services. Semantic services are separated into a separate category. This term denotes software tools, in the functionality of which queries to subject ontologies are used to ensure the management of knowledge objects. General descriptions of developed subject ontologies are given: educational mathematical ontology OntoMathEdu and ontology of professional mathematics OntoMathPRO. The development of educational ontology is reflected in the direction of including educational prerequisite links between classes. Among the software tools of the digital ecosystem, search services for mathematical electronic collections, a service for semantic annotation of mathematical documents, tools for semantic marking of educational mathematical documents, as well as a system for automatically generating testing tests in mathematical educational disciplines are highlighted. As part of the OntoMath digital ecosystem, special-purpose recommender systems are being developed. The current version of the ecosystem includes a recommender system for generating a list of related articles based on the OntoMathPRO ontology, a recommender system for appointing experts to support the scientific review process, and recommender systems for selecting subject classifiers UDC and Mathematics Subject Classification codes for mathematical documents. The results are also presented in the direction of creating a digital library metadata factory, which includes services and tools for extracting, refining, replenishing and normalizing the metadata of electronic mathematical collections. Note that the OntoMath ecosystem is being developed as the technological basis for the Lobachevskii Digital Mathematical Library.

The Use of Thematic Analysis Methods in Scientometric Systems

Alexander Sergeevich Kozitsyn, Sergey Alexandrovich Afonin, Dmitry Alekseevich Shachnev
315-338
Abstract:

Modern scientometric systems and citation systems use various mechanisms of thematic search and thematic filtering of information. In most cases, a full-text approach is used for thematic analysis of articles and journals, which has a number of limitations. The use of algorithms based on graph analysis, both independently and in conjunction with full-text algorithms, eliminates these limitations and improves the completeness and accuracy of subject search. The algorithm developed by the authors and presented in this work uses the co-authorship graph to analyze the thematic proximity of journals. The algorithm is insensitive to the language of the journal and selects similar journals in different languages, which is difficult to implement for algorithms based on the analysis of full-text information. The algorithm was tested in the scientometric system IAS ISTINA. In the interface developed for these purposes, the user can select one journal that is close to him on the subject, and the system will automatically generate a selection of journals that may be of interest to the user both in terms of studying the materials available in them and in terms of publishing his own articles. In the future, the developed algorithm can be adapted to search for similar conferences, collections of publications and scientific projects. The presence of such a tool will increase the publication activity of young employees, increase the citation rate of articles and the citation rate between journals. The results of the algorithm for determining thematic proximity between journals, collections, conferences and scientific projects can also be used to build rules in models of differentiating access to data based on domain ontologies.

Recommender System in the Process of Scientific Peer Review in Mathematical Journal

Alexander Mikhailovich Elizarov, Evgeny Konstantinovich Lipachev, Shamil Makhmutovich Khaydarov
708-732
Abstract: An approach is proposed for organizing expert evaluation of a scientific document submitted to a mathematical journal. Domain restriction is associated with the use of the Mathematical Sciences Classification System – MSC. A recommendation system is presented that allows you to create a list of possible experts for conducting scientific peer-reviewing on a mathematical article. The recommender system uses the MSC codes presented by the author of the article on the MSC2020 classifiers. If the codes MSC2000 or MSC2010 are indicated in the article, they are automatically converted to codes MSC2020. For each expert, the system supports a personal profile that contains a set of codes MSC2020, supplemented by numerical characteristics – weights calculated for each code in accordance with the system of accounting for competencies, preferences or refusals to participate in the review procedure. This set is automatically edited if the expert is included in the list of possible reviewers – the weights of several codes increase or decrease, as well as new codes are added. The recommendation system is implemented as an integrated tool (plug-in) of the Open Journal Systems (OJS) platform. The developed method has been tested in the information system of the Lobachevskii Journal of Mathematics (https://ljm.kpfu.ru).

Extraction of aspects of goods and services from consumers reviews using conditional random fields model

Юлия Владимировна Рубцова, Сергей Андреевич Кошельников
203-221
Abstract:

This paper describes the Information extraction system that was presented at SentiRuEval-2015: aspect-based sentiment analysis of users' reviews in Russian. The proposed system uses a conditional random field algorithm to extract aspect terms mentioned in the text. A set of morphological features was used for machine learning. The system intent to perform two subtasks, Task A – automatic extraction of explicit aspects and Task B – automatic extraction of all aspects (explicit, implicit and sentiment facts), and tested on two domains: restaurants and automobiles. Our systems performed competitively and showed the results comparable to those of the other 10 participants.

Basic Services of Factory Metadata Digital Mathematical Library Lobachevskii-Dml

Polina Gafurova, Alexander Elizarov, Evgeny Konstantinovich Lipachev
336-381
Abstract: A number of problems related to the construction of the metadata factory of the digital mathematical library Lobachevskii-DML have been solved. By metadata factory we mean a system of interconnected software tools aimed at creating, processing, storing and managing metadata of digital library objects and allowing integrating created electronic collections into aggregating digital scientific libraries. In order to select the optimal such software tools from existing ones and their modernization:we discussed the features of the presentation of the metadata of documents of various electronic collections related both to the formats used and to changes in the composition and completeness of the set of metadata throughout the entire publication of the corresponding scientific journal;we presented and characterized software tools for managing scientific content and methods for organizing automated integration of repositories of mathematical documents with other information systems;we discussed such an important function of the digital library metadata factory as the normalization of metadata in accordance with the formats of other aggregating libraries.As a result of the development of the metadata factory of the digital mathematical library Lobachevskii-DML, we proposed a system of services for the automated generation of metadata for electronic mathematical collections; we have developed an xml metadata presentation language based on the Journal Archiving and Interchange Tag Suite (NISO JATS); we have created software tools for normalizing metadata of electronic collections of scientific documents in formats developed by international organizations – aggregators of resources in mathematics and Computer Science; we have developed an algorithm for converting metadata to oai_dc format and generating the archive structure for import into DSpace digital storage; we have proposed and implemented methods for integrating electronic mathematical collections of Kazan University into domestic and foreign digital mathematical libraries.

The Two-Level Information and Analytical Control System for Intelligent Traffic Lights

Maxim Vladimirovich Bobyr, Natalia Igorevna Khrapova
696-717
Abstract:

In the modern world, the problems arising in the field of traffic are of great importance. In order to solve existing problems, various intelligent systems are being developed, one of which is the Smart City system. This work is devoted to the development of an information and analytical system (IAS) for controlling an intelligent traffic light. The presented system consists of two levels, each of which contains a set of specific operations. The first level is responsible for detecting objects, in particular pedestrians and cars at the intersection, and the second level calculates the operating time of traffic light signals for the control signal that is transmitted to the device. For comparative analysis, the combined method (HOG+SVM) Histogram of oriented gradients was chosen, based on counting the number of gradient directions on individual image areas and Support Vector Machines, which are used to construct hyperplanes in n-dimensional space in order to separate objects belonging to different classes. The results of an experimental study, during which the recognition of objects in images was carried out, showed the superiority of the developed information and analytical system over existing methods. The average accuracy of detecting pedestrians and cars through the IAS was 69.4%. In addition, according to the experiment, it was concluded that the accuracy of detecting objects in images is directly proportional to the distance from the video camera to the object.

Information System for Registering the Result of Scientific Institution Employees’ Intellectual Activity

Svetlana Aleksandrovna Vlasova, Nikolay Evgenevich Kalenov
218-237
Abstract:

The article describes a typical object-oriented WEB-system designed for storing and providing various reference and statistical data on the scientific works of employees of an institution (group of institutions), developed by specialists of the JSCC RAS. The system contains information about publications of employees and reports made by them at scientific conferences, symposiums, and seminars. The system is focused on working with objects belonged to classes connected between each other, such as "author", "organization", "publication", "report", "event". The metadata profile of objects of each class includes attributes that are necessary to get detailed information about both an individual object of this class and a group of objects associated with the specified attribute values of objects of other classes. For example, you have to get a list of articles by employees of a given organization published articles in a given journal for a given period of time. A distinctive feature of the system is the introduced concept of "equivalent" objects. Such objects are "persons" corresponding to the same author with different spellings of the last name in the bibliographic descriptions of publications; organizations with different versions of names; articles which are published without changes in different languages. This article describes in detail the features of the system, its user interface, and provides examples of performing specific queries.

Multitrading Analytical System

Felix Osvaldovich Kasparinsky
796–945
Abstract:

The multitrading analytical system is designed for operational, tactical and strategic forecasting of price changes of various financial instruments in the Forex market using the Metatrader 5 computer Internet terminal. In the Analytical windows of the terminal, a functional distribution of 17 indicators of technical analysis is organized into Sections of Price, Oscillations, Trends and Control. When setting up complex indicators of Price Equilibrium Level, Oscillation Distribution, Trend Potential and Oscillation Group Trend, a technique is used to connect trend indicators to oscillator data. Complex indicators unmask the stages of formation of elementary price oscillations and their groups (packets of 4 oscillations, blocks of 2 packages and modules of 4 blocks), and help establish the location of pivot points of price channels. For synchronous analysis of operational, tactical and strategic trends in price changes of one financial instrument, the Analytical Display combines six Analytical windows with a sequential increase in the time scale of interval charts (timeframes) by 4 times. Regulations have been developed for multiscale marking, design and use of Andrews pitchforks for forecasting long-term trends. Operational and tactical forecasts are visualized using multi-scale trend arrows in the Zone of Actual Oscillations. A technique is proposed for combining the tools of fundamental and technical analysis to determine the probability of the onset and relative significance of fundamental events that are not contained in the economic calendar.

Development of the Information System for Registering the Result of Scientific Institution’ Employees Intellectual Activity

Svetlana Aleksandrovna Vlasova, Nikolay Evgenevich Kalenov
770-793
Abstract:

The article describes a Web-system developed by the authors that implements services related to the formation and provision of multifaceted information about the results of scientific activities (publications, copyright certificates and reports at scientific events) of employees of an organization or a group of organizations. The system is focused both on the end user interested in obtaining specific data, and on the administrative staff, who generates reporting materials for the parent organization. The information base of the system contains metadata on the following classes of objects: persons (authors), organizations and their subdivisions; publications at analytical, monographic and summary levels; copyright certificates; scientific events (conferences, symposia, seminars); reports. The system includes two modules – an administrative one (intended for entering and editing data) and a user one, which is a special search engine that searches for information, visualizes it, provides navigation among related resources and exports data. A distinctive feature of the system is the introduced concept of “equivalent” objects. Objects are considered equivalent if they are represented in the system by different metadata, but referring to the same physical entity. Such objects are “persons” corresponding to one author with different spellings of the surname in the bibliographic descriptions of publications; organizations with different variants of names; articles published unchanged in various languages. In accordance with modern requirements for reporting on publications, the system reflects the sources of research funding, as well as the affiliations indicated in the articles for each author.

Semantic Services of the Digital Ecosystem Ontomath for Mathematical Education

Olga Avenirovna Nevzorova, Evgeny Konstantinovich Lipachev, Konstantin Sergeevich Nikolaev
538–569
Abstract:

We present a set of semantic services developed by us to support the educational process in mathematics. The functionality of these services is based on the use of mathematical ontologies OntoMathEdu and OntoMathPRO. The ontology of professional mathematical knowledge OntoMathPRO is designed to classify and systematize the concepts of professional mathematics and includes several important areas of mathematics. Educational mathematical ontology OntoMathEdu systematically represents knowledge on the training course “Planimetry”. For the use of ontologies in educational applications, an approach to the design of prerequisite relations in these ontologies has been developed. To support mathematical education, we have developed: a service for semantic search by mathematical formulas, a service for semantic annotation of educational materials, a service for visualizing subgraphs of the OntoMathEdu ontology semantic network, a parallel formal/informal corpus of mathematical statements, a system for automatically generating test questions in mathematical disciplines.


We provide examples of successful application of the developed software tools.


The created software tools are built into the OntoMath digital ecosystem. This ecosystem implements the interaction of semantic services for managing mathematical knowledge.

Semantic Recommendation Service for Assigning UDC Code to Mathematical Articles

Olga Avenirovna Nevzorova, Damir Albertovich Almukhametov
203–224
Abstract:

Classification of documents with the assignment of classifier codes is a traditional way of systematizing and searching for documents on a specific topic. The Universal Decimal Classification (UDC) underlies the systematization of knowledge presented in libraries, databases and other information repositories. In Russia, UDC is an obligatory attribute of all book production and information on natural and technical sciences. The choice of classification codes is associated with the analysis of the structure of the classifier tree and is traditionally decided by the author of a scientific article. This article proposes a solution for automating the assigning the UDC classification code for a mathematical article based on a special resource – the OntoMathPRO ontology for professional mathematics, developed at Kazan Federal University. An approach to solving the problem is to create "code maps" for each classifying code in the UDC tree in the field of mathematics. Under the "code map" is meant a weighted set of all extracted, with the help of OntoMathPRO ontology, mathematical named entities from the collection of articles with a given UDC code. The creation of "code maps" is based on the hypothesis that the choice of the UDC code is determined by a certain set of classifying features that can be represented by classes from the OntoMathPRO ontology. The proposed hypothesis was tested and confirmed in the paper.
